Tool Ren'Py UnRen.bat v1.0.11d - RPA Extractor, RPYC Decompiler, Console/Developer Menu Enabler

5.00 star(s) 9 Votes

Dylan Dog

Newbie
Jun 5, 2022
22
42
I Went through last couple of pages and I didn't see that anyone reported an error that I get but only on very few games. Python is working, unren start unpacking the archive but then goes through all the image files and says "Could not extract file xxx.png from blabla... the object has no attribute 'encode'. It happens only in like 2-3% of the games at the most. Everything else works fine
 

Merge2000

New Member
Jul 30, 2022
6
0
I Went through last couple of pages and I didn't see that anyone reported an error that I get but only on very few games. Python is working, unren start unpacking the archive but then goes through all the image files and says "Could not extract file xxx.png from blabla... the object has no attribute 'encode'. It happens only in like 2-3% of the games at the most. Everything else works fine
Are you use the Unren-Version matching the Renpy Version of the Game (game\script_version.txt)?
 

Dylan Dog

Newbie
Jun 5, 2022
22
42
Yes I use the right Ren'Py. I can unpack other games with same version of Ren'py in their game/script_version.txt without any problems. It is just a really small number of them that report this error I posted above
 

Walter Victor

Forum Fanatic
Dec 27, 2017
5,645
19,532
https://f95zone.to/threads/ripples-ep-1-remaster-beta-jestur.56110/
anyone unpacked this? no unren version works, always error Cannot locate python.exe, unable to continue.
[CITAZIONE="dacris69, post: 8865042, membro: 299172"]
https://f95zone.to/threads/ripples-ep-1-remaster-beta-jestur.56110/
qualcuno l'ha scompattato? nessuna versione unren funziona, sempre errore Impossibile individuare python.exe, impossibile continuare.
[/CITAZIONE]
Renpy version?
This thread does not have the latest stuff.

Try over here:

Link to VepsrP's thread

I used UnRen-ultrahack(v6) on that same download and it worked just fine.
 

dacris69

M, TI
Donor
Nov 20, 2017
2,149
6,093
Hmm i tested on other games with other renpy versions, i get the same error, what could cause it? i need something else installed?
its been around 2 months since ive played any VN but i remember working fine then, im on w10
 

Walter Victor

Forum Fanatic
Dec 27, 2017
5,645
19,532
UnRen doesn't recognize more and more games, Being a DIK, Ripples....
I've been using UnRen on Being a DIK since it came out, up to and including the Interlude release. I have also successfully used UnRen on the latest release of Ripples. You are not on the thread that has the UnRen release that works on those games.

See the link in my post 3 posts before yours.
 

ttytty12

New Member
Jun 19, 2022
9
4
it have error ,choose 1 it unpack file rpa ,but choose 2 display is no .rpyc files found ,mean no have file rpy ,so how can fix it ??
 

Walter Victor

Forum Fanatic
Dec 27, 2017
5,645
19,532
none of the versions work for me, i guess there is no alternative to unren?
You are right, there is no alternative to UnRen. But if you would read some of the posts on this page, especially mine, you would learn that the owner of THIS thread has not updated his version of the tool in ages, and that another person (on another thread) is actually working on versions that work.

It's over here

I can promise you that the version of UnRen there works on Ripples. I've done it.
 

Walter Victor

Forum Fanatic
Dec 27, 2017
5,645
19,532
it have error ,choose 1 it unpack file rpa ,but choose 2 display is no .rpyc files found ,mean no have file rpy ,so how can fix it ??
The version of UnRen you are using probably doesn't check in subdirectories for .rpyc files. But, check the link in my post just above this one, for a version that should work for you.
 

dacris69

M, TI
Donor
Nov 20, 2017
2,149
6,093
I tried all those versions and older ones, except windowed , i get error with all of them on newer renpy versions. No idea why, i would try the windowed version but cant figure out how lol.
 

Walter Victor

Forum Fanatic
Dec 27, 2017
5,645
19,532
I tried all those versions and older ones, except windowed , i get error with all of them on newer renpy versions. No idea why, i would try the windowed version but cant figure out how lol.
IF you tried the versions on the other thread and they didn't work, then ask your question over there.
 

RetroDen86

New Member
Aug 31, 2022
4
1
View attachment 1065329

I had originally created this script for myself, but I've decided to clean it up a bit and release it for everyone. You can extract RPA archives (using built in ), decompile RPYC files (using built in ), enable the console and developer menu for Ren'Py games and more.

No dependencies, no internet connection required. You can right click->edit to see the source. Works on Windows 7, 8 and 10. XP and Vista users might need this PowerShell update from Microsoft:

Instructions:
1. Copy UnRen.bat to either the game's root directory (where the exe is) or the /game/ folder
2. Double click on UnRen.bat to execute
3. Select the option you require

Both RPA and RPYC files will be extracted/decompiled to the same path as the original files.

Known Issues:
- Having non-ASCII characters in your folder path may cause issues

Let me know if you encounter any issues or bugs.

Contributions:
If you'd like to contribute any changes or improvements, check out the new (currently out of date)

You don't have permission to view the spoiler content. Log in or register now.
You don't have permission to view the spoiler content. Log in or register now.
Looks like you need an update. Ren'Py 8.0.1.22070801 blocks it.

Code:
   ! Error: Cannot locate python.exe, unable to continue.
            Are you sure we're in the game's root or game directory?

            Press any key to exit...
 

fried

Almost
Moderator
Donor
Nov 11, 2017
2,311
6,080
I was getting tired of Ren'Py 8.* breaking this utility (in terms of Python location and/or RPA format), so the OP has been updated with a v1.00 UnRen.bat that can also handle newer Ren'Py installs (while remaining backwards-compatible with older games.)

A couple other alterations, too - see the Change log for details.

Feel free to report bugs here and/or via DM.
 

KeraliKara

New Member
Sep 1, 2022
1
0
У меня не открывается с новыми играми Renpy.

Помогите пожалуйста.

Can't open for me with new Renpy games.
Help me please.
 

fried

Almost
Moderator
Donor
Nov 11, 2017
2,311
6,080
У меня не открывается с новыми играми Renpy.

Помогите пожалуйста.

Can't open for me with new Renpy games.
Help me please.
Please download https://attachments.f95zone.to/2022/09/2042787_UnRen-1.00.zip from the OP, extract "UnRen-1.00.bat" and place it into either the root of the game's folder or within the "<game root>\game" folder, then double click to run; select the option(s) you need one-at-a-time and check for expected results.
 
  • Like
Reactions: oracle255
5.00 star(s) 9 Votes